- Fiesta de la Virgen de la Victoria, a vibrant celebration honoring the patron saint of Melilla with processions, music, and fireworks
- Festival Internacional de Música de Melilla, an annual music festival featuring diverse genres and international artists
- Feria de Melilla, a lively fair with rides, games, and traditional food celebrating local culture.
- Easter, vibrant religious processions and cultural festivities
- Labor Day, lively local celebrations and a festive atmosphere
- Assumption of Mary, unique local traditions and a chance to experience Melilla's rich heritage.
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
